How to draw Mason Dipper Pines Glitched legends

The hardest part of drawing Mason Dipper Pines Glitched Legends is handling the contrast between the normal half of the character and the corrupted side, where a massive dark mass replaces the lower body and one arm turns into a clawed nightmare. What Makes This Version of Dipper a Different Kind of Drawing Challenge

The tutorial runs 29 steps and covers a full-body build with no background, so every step goes toward the character. The bulk of the complexity sits in the lower half, where the glitched dark mass has an organic, flowing shape with no clean edges to anchor on. The upper body stays relatively grounded with recognizable clothing and a face to establish structure, but the transition zone between normal and corrupted is where most people will need to slow down and sketch loosely before committing to lines.

Key Visual Details to Keep in Mind

  • Baseball cap with a lightning bolt symbol
  • Round glasses and open mouth expression
  • White short-sleeve shirt, dark lower body mass
  • One arm dark with large sharp claws
  • Other hand holds a small round object

Understanding the Step Color System

Each step image uses a three-color coding to show what is new and what came before:

  • Red Color: lines added in the current step.
  • Black Color: lines completed earlier.
  • Gray Color: base sketch for structure.
